Overview

Cloud contact center that unifies inbound and outbound voice, SMS, web chat and email in a single agent desktop. Skills-based routing, real-time supervision, AI-assisted scripting and full CRM integration.

What's included

  • Omnichannel: voice, SMS, web chat, email
  • Predictive, progressive and preview dialers
  • Skills-based routing and queues
  • Real-time wallboards + supervisor coaching
  • AI transcription, sentiment and QA scoring
  • Salesforce, HubSpot, Zendesk integration
